// +build linux darwin freebsd solaris package devices import ( "fmt" "os" "syscall" "golang.org/x/sys/unix" ) func DeviceInfo(fi os.FileInfo) (uint64, uint64, error) { sys, ok := fi.Sys().(*syscall.Stat_t) if !ok { return 0, 0, fmt.Errorf("cannot extract device from os.FileInfo") } dev := uint64(sys.Rdev) return uint64(unix.Major(dev)), uint64(unix.Minor(dev)), nil } // mknod provides a shortcut for syscall.Mknod func Mknod(p string, mode os.FileMode, maj, min int) error { var ( m = syscallMode(mode.Perm()) dev uint64 ) if mode&os.ModeDevice != 0 { dev = unix.Mkdev(uint32(maj), uint32(min)) if mode&os.ModeCharDevice != 0 { m |= unix.S_IFCHR } else { m |= unix.S_IFBLK } } else if mode&os.ModeNamedPipe != 0 { m |= unix.S_IFIFO } return unix.Mknod(p, m, int(dev)) } // syscallMode returns the syscall-specific mode bits from Go's portable mode bits. func syscallMode(i os.FileMode) (o uint32) { o |= uint32(i.Perm()) if i&os.ModeSetuid != 0 { o |= unix.S_ISUID } if i&os.ModeSetgid != 0 { o |= unix.S_ISGID } if i&os.ModeSticky != 0 { o |= unix.S_ISVTX } return }
